"This work deals with numerical modelling of laminar and turbulent flow over an swept wing. As the governing system of equation the system of Reynolds averaged Navier-Stokes equations was chosen. Numerical solution was realized by two diferent cell-centered schemes of the finite volume method, namely the Modified Causon's scheme and WLSQR scheme with HLLC numerical flux. Turbulence effects are simulated by two models of turbulence - the Kok's TNT model and Spalart-Allmaras model. Obtained results are compared with experimental data with a very good agreement.
